研究概览

简要总结

To investigate the influence of two physical activity and exercising (PAE) interventions, namely resistance training and endurance training in relation to quality of life, depression, fatigue, sleep, anxiety, stress and coping, body image, and social interactions (psychological dimensions); cardiorespiratory fitness, morning cortisol secretion, inflammatory markers, and objective sleep (physiological dimensions), along with cancer-related dimensions

详细描述

Patients with high grade glioma (WHO III° and IV°) and undergoing radiotherapy, chemotherapy, or both radio- and chemotherapy suffer from decreased quality of life (QoL). This study is to analyse the influence of two adjuvant interventions of physical activity and exercising (PAE) (namely resistance training and endurance training) in relation to quality of life, depression, fatigue, sleep, anxiety, stress and coping, body image, and social interactions (psychological dimensions); cardiorespiratory fitness, morning cortisol secretion, inflammatory markers, and objective sleep (physiological dimensions).

结局指标

主要结局

Change in Hamilton Depression Rating Scale (HDRS)

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

HDRS scale to assess patients' severity of Depression (mood, feelings of guilt, suicide ideation, insomnia, agitation or retardation, anxiety, weight loss, and somatic symptoms); each item on the questionnaire is scored on a 3 or 5 point scale; a score of 0-7 is considered to be normal

Change in Perceived Stress Scale (PSS)

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

General perceived stress is assessed with the 10-item Perceived Stress Scale (PSS). The PSS measures the degree to which respondents find their lives unpredictable, uncontrollable and overloading. Answers were given on a five-point Likert-type scale anchored at 1 (never) to 5 (very often). Four items were reverse scored. The mean was calculated in order to obtain an overall score.

Change in Functional Assessment of Cancer Therapy Scale (FACT)

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

Cancer-related Quality of Life (QOL) assessed by Functional Assessment of Cancer Therapy Scale (FACT), a self-report instrument which measures multidimensional QOL. The FACT evaluation system uses a 29-49 item compilation of a generic core and numerous subscales (9-20 items each) which reflect symptoms associated with different diseases, symptom complexes and treatments.

Change in Intolerance of Uncertainty Scale (IU)

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

IU: 5-point rating scale (1 = not at all characteristic of me, 5 = entirely characteristic of me) indicating how much patient agrees with the item. The higher the overall score is, the more the respondent is assumed to be more intolerant of uncertainty

Change in Mental Toughness Questionnaire (MTQ48)

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

The 48 item MTQ48 measures the subcomponents challenge, commitment, emotional and life control, and interpersonal confidence and confidence in ability. Answers are given on five-point Likert-type scales ranging from 1 (=strongly disagree) to 5 (=strongly agree), with higher scores reflecting greater MT

Change in International Physical Activity Questionnaire

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

questionnaire consists of several items and asks about the amount of days with walking, moderate and vigorous physical activity.

Change in Insomnia Severity Index (ISI)

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

ISI is a 7-item screening measure for insomnia. Items answered on 5-point rating scales (0 = not at all, 4 = very much)

Change in Fatigue Severity Scale

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

nine items, and answers are given on seven-point rating scales ranging from 1 (not at all) to 7 (definitively/almost always), with higher mean scores reflecting greater fatigue

Change in submaximal 6-min walking test (6MWT)

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

To assess functional exercise capacity, distance walked during 6 min will be assessed and compared to reference age and gender norms

Change in Grip force

时间窗: Baseline and week 3 and week 6

Maximum isometric grip force of the dominant hand is assessed using the hand dynamometer. Participants make three attempts. Mean outcomes is compared to reference data
